#4d7266 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d7266 is composed of 30.2% red, 44.7%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.5%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 160.5 degrees, a saturation of 19.4% and a lightness of 37.5%. #4d7266 color hex could be obtained by blending #9ae4cc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#4d7266 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4d7266 has RGB values of R:77, G:114,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 5075558.

Shades and Tints of #4d7266
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060908 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4d7266
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c6361 is the less saturated color, while #04bb80 is the most saturated one.
